Diether is a German given name, composed of the elements diet "people" and her "army".

It is distinct from, but in Modern German has become homophonic with, the name Dieter, which is a short form of Dietrich, composed of the same prefix but the unrelated suffix rihhi "rich".

People called Diether include:

  • Diether von Isenburg (d. 1482)
  • Diether von Roeder (d. 1918), eponymous of German destroyer Z17 Diether von Roeder
  • Diether Lukesch (1918-2004)
  • Diether Posser (1922-2010)
  • Diether Haenicke (1935-2009)
  • Diether Krebs (1947–2000)
  • Diether Ocampo (b. 1974)
